Insurance Verification Scheduler information

What does an insurance verification scheduler do?

An Insurance Verification Scheduler is responsible for verifying a patient's insurance coverage and benefits before medical appointments or procedures. They contact insurance companies to confirm eligibility, benefits, and any requirements for pre-authorization. Additionally, they communicate with patients about their coverage, ensure accurate billing information, and help prevent delays in care due to insurance issues. Their work is essential to streamline patient access to healthcare services and minimize denied claims.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an insurance verification scheduler,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Insurance Verification Scheduler, you need strong attention to detail, knowledge of insurance processes, and familiarity with medical terminology, often backed by a high school diploma or equivalent. Experience with insurance verification software, electronic health records (EHRs), and scheduling systems is typically required. Excellent communication, organization, and problem-solving skills help build rapport with patients and collaborate effectively with healthcare teams. These skills ensure accurate insurance verification, minimize billing errors, and support a smooth patient experience.

What are common challenges faced by insurance verification schedulers, and how can they be addressed?

Insurance Verification Schedulers often encounter challenges such as managing high call volumes, navigating complex insurance policies, and ensuring timely communication between patients, providers, and insurance companies. Staying organized and detail-oriented is crucial, as missing information can delay patient care and create additional work. Utilizing electronic health records (EHR) systems and maintaining strong relationships with both clinical and administrative teams can help streamline the verification process and reduce errors.

What is the difference between Insurance Verification Scheduler vs Insurance Billing Specialist?

AspectInsurance Verification SchedulerInsurance Billing Specialist
Primary RoleSchedule and verify insurance coverage before patient appointmentsProcess and submit insurance claims after services are provided
CredentialsTypically high school diploma or equivalent; certification not mandatoryHigh school diploma; certification in medical billing preferred
Work EnvironmentFront-office, healthcare clinics, hospitalsBilling departments, healthcare offices, hospitals
Industry UsageCommonly used in outpatient clinics and hospitalsUsed across healthcare providers for claims processing

The Insurance Verification Scheduler focuses on confirming insurance coverage prior to patient visits, ensuring smooth scheduling. In contrast, the Insurance Billing Specialist handles post-visit billing and claims submission. Both roles are essential in healthcare revenue cycle management but differ in timing and responsibilities.

How do you become an insurance verification scheduler?

To become an insurance verification scheduler, candidates typically need a high school diploma or equivalent and strong organizational and communication skills. Experience with healthcare billing, insurance processes, or scheduling software can be beneficial, and some employers may require familiarity with electronic health record systems. Certification is not usually mandatory but can enhance job prospects.

Is it hard to learn insurance verification scheduler?

Learning to be an insurance verification scheduler involves understanding insurance policies, verification procedures, and using scheduling or healthcare management software. The role typically requires attention to detail and good communication skills but is generally accessible with training and practice, often provided by employers. Prior experience in healthcare or insurance can be helpful but is not always necessary for entry-level positions.

Responsibilities:
  • Review patient insurance coverage and eligibility; correcting and updating in our system when necessary.
  • Validate and obtain referrals, pre-certification and/or prior authorizations via fax, online, or telephone for scheduled appointments.
  • Communicate directly with patients, providers and/or their clinical staff.
  • Document prior authorization information into the patient EMR to ensure accurate and timely claims filing.
  • Comprehend and determine insurance deductible, co-insurance, co-payments, and out-of-pocket costs to provide patients their financial responsibilities prior to arrival.
  • Assist administrative front desk with day-to-day operations, when necessary.
  • Complete any additional job duties as assigned.

Qualifications:
  • A high school diploma or GED is required.
  • Must be able to pass a general skills test.
  • General knowledge of ICD-10 and CPT coding.
  • Prior authorization experience is helpful but not required.
  • Medical terminology helpful but not required.
